jan 1, 1935 - Wagner Act

Description:

The Wagner Act is passed, guaranteeing the right of private sector employees to organize into trade unions, engage in collective bargaining, and take collective action such as strikes. The Congress of Industrial Organizations (CIO) is founded as a federation of unions that organized workers in industrial unions. Unlike its rival the AFL, the CIO allowed blacks and unskilled workers to join.
